52t Albion
Words: Isaac Watts, 1707
Music: Robert Boyd, 1816
Meter: Short Meter (6,6,8,6)
Come, ye that love the Lord,
And let your joys be known;
Join in a song with sweet accord,
While ye surround His throne.
Let those refuse to sing
Who never knew our God,
But servants of the heav’nly King
May speak their joys abroad.
The men of grace have found
Glory begun below;
Celestial fruits on earthly ground
From faith and hope may grow.
